Abstract
The purpose of the article is three-fold. The first is to get the Navier-Stokes equations in the toroidal coordinates by the methods of Riemannian geometry, which govern the motion of flows confined in a nested tori with inner torus rotating at a constant horizontal angular velocity. The second is to obtain the corresponding steady-state solutions by using the Implicit Function Theorem and iterative techniques. The last objective is to show the linear stability of the derived steady-states.
